Ball State announces new deputy AD

Hardin hired from Notre Dame, will start Monday

Ball State’s athletic department now has more Notre Dame influence as Brian Hardin was named as Ball State’s deputy athletics director, according to athletic director Bill Scholl.

Hardin, who spent the last seven years as the director of football media relations at Notre Dame, will have responsibility for most of the athletic department’s externally focused functions as well as supervision of several sports programs. He will also serve as a member of the senior leadership team that focuses on the department’s goals and strategies.

“We are extremely pleased to be able to announce the hiring of Brian Hardin at Ball State,” Scholl said in a news release. “He is an quality individual who I have worked very closely with in the past. Brian will bring a great amount of energy and knowledge to Ball State.”

Hardin had been the primary media contact for the Notre Dame football team to outlets since 2006 and was the spokesperson for Notre Dame football.

He was a member of Notre Dame athletic director Jack Swarbrick’s senior staff committee since 2010.

“I am thrilled to have received this opportunity to join the athletics department at Ball State,” Hardin said in a news release. “I have known Bill Scholl for almost seven years and look forward to working with him again.”

Hardin is expected to begin at Ball State Monday.
